π Description
I have had a non-visual encounter and one visual encounter all within a couple miles of each other. The non-visual encounter involved being followed by a prominent knocking sound through a heavily wooded area. The knocks came from ground level and followed me and another man for some time. The other individual is a hunting guide and spends extended periods in the mountains. He had never experienced or heard anything like that before. The visual encounter occurred at the summit of a nearby mountain: Monroe Mountain. Me and my father-in-law were scouting elk when we came across a big mountain goat that we followed out of curiosity. When we lost him we turned around and I saw two figures maybe 300 yards away, a taller one a shorter one, walking in the opposite direction from us. They looked very dark brown or even black and my impression was they were not human. My father-in-law did not see them but I insisted we drive over to where I saw them. It was a rocky ledge that ended in maybe a 20 foot drop. Whatever I saw was completely gone from sight in the maybe 60 seconds it took us to get there. The snow was old and hard this time of year, but there was a pair of tracks leading to the cliff edge.
